Baseball Standings

School NAC Overall
Edgewood 17-5 29-15
Rockford 17-5 27-14-1
Concordia Wisconsin 16-6 22-18
Aurora 16-6 27-16
Concordia Chicago 16-6 31-9
Lakeland 12-10 21-19
Benedictine 12-10 17-23
Marian 8-14 12-26
MSOE 7-15 12-27
Wisconsin Lutheran 7-15 11-26
Dominican 4-18 11-25
Maranatha 0-22 4-25

Spartan alum signs professional contract
AURORA, Ill. -- Aurora University Spartan baseball 2010 graduate Kirk Williamson (catcher) has signed a professional contract with the Rockford Riverhawks, an independent team based out of Rockford, Ill., in the Northern League.

CUC's Isaac scoops up second Rawlings' Gold Glove honor
RIVER FOREST, Ill. -- Concordia University Chicago first baseman Brandon Isaac (Matteson, Ill. – Marian Catholic H.S.) has earned the prestigious Rawlings NCAA Division III Gold Glove award as selected by the American Baseball Coaches Association for a second consecutive season.

Jusk, Standridge lead NAC baseball awards
WAUKESHA, Wis. -- The Northern Athletics Conference has announced the All-NAC awards for the 2010 baseball season. The awards, as selected by the baseball coaches of the NAC, include a 15-member First Team, honorable mention selections, a 10 member All-Freshman team, a 12-member All-Sportsmanship team and the four major awards of Position Player, Pitcher, Freshman and Coach of the Year. This year's First Team All-NAC was expanded to 16 members due to a tie at the catcher's position.

NAC Baseball Tournament opens on Friday in Loves Park, Ill.
MADISON, Wis. –- After an exciting and highly competitive regular season, only four teams remain to vie for the Northern Athletics Conference Baseball Tournament title and the NCAA Tournament automatic bid that comes with it. Edgewood College earned the No. 1 seed after winning a tiebreaker with Rockford College who is the second seed. Concordia Wisconsin is the third seed after winning a tiebreak with No. 4 seed Aurora University and Concordia Chicago.

Seven baseball, four softball NAC student-athletes named to CoSIDA/ESPN the Magazine Academic All-District teams
WAUKESHA, Wis. -- The 2010 CoSIDA/ESPN the Magazine Academic All-District Team for baseball and softball were announced by College Sports Information Directors of America (CoSIDA) last week, and 11 student-athletes from Northern Athletics Conference teams received honors. To be eligible for the honor, nominated student-athletes are required to maintain a minimum 3.30 cumulative grade point average throughout their academic career.

Edgewood College, Verona High School team up to "Strike Out Cancer"
VERONA, Wis. -- The Edgewood College and Verona Area High School baseball teams will be teaming up this Saturday to win baseball games and help defeat cancer. The two teams have joined forces with the Breast Cancer Recovery Foundation of Madison for a "Strike Out Cancer" Awareness Day on Saturday, May 8 at their shared home park, Stampfl Field in Verona.

Regents look to strike out cancer
ROCKFORD, Ill. -- On Sunday, May 2, the Rockford College baseball team will be doing its part to fight a disease that affects millions of people each year. The Regents will be raising money to help bring awareness to the fight against breast cancer when they host the Concordia University Chicago Cougars at Road Ranger Stadium. First pitch is scheduled for 3 p.m.
